Biba — My account debited but order showing as failed

Address:Delhi
Website:[email protected]

My order no 11883699 is showing as payment failed, whereas my amount has been debited from my account. None of their customer care no. Gets connected. And mails are not responded.
Was this information helpful?
No (0)
Yes (0)
Aug 14, 2020
Updated by hardeep jolly
My order no 11883699 is showing as payment failed, whereas my amount has been debited from my account. None of their customer care no. gets connected. And mails are not responded.
Complaint comments 

Post your Comment

    I want to submit Complaint Positive Review Neutral Comment
    code
    By clicking Submit you agree to our Terms of Use
    Submit

    Contact Information

    Delhi
    India
    File a Complaint